From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:
Unclean \Un*clean"\ ([u^]n*kl[=e]n"), a. [AS. uncl[=ae]ne. See
{Unnot}, and {Clean}.]
1. Not clean; foul; dirty; filthy.
[1913 Webster]
2. Ceremonially impure; needing ritual cleansing.
[1913 Webster]
He that toucheth the dead body of any man shall be
unclean seven days. --Num. xix.
11.
[1913 Webster]
3. Morally impure. "Adultery of the heart, consisting of
inordinate and unclean affections." --Perkins.
[1913 Webster] -- {Un*clean"ly}, adv. -- {Un*clean"ness},
n.
[1913 Webster]
{Unclean animals} (Script.), those which the Israelites were
forbidden to use for food.
{Unclean spirit} (Script.), a wicked spirit; a demon. --Mark
i. 27.
[1913 Webster]
From WordNet (r) 3.0 (2006) [wn]:
unclean
adj 1: soiled or likely to soil with dirt or grime; "dirty
unswept sidewalks"; "a child in dirty overalls"; "dirty
slums"; "piles of dirty dishes"; "put his dirty feet on
the clean sheet"; "wore an unclean shirt"; "mining is a
dirty job"; "Cinderella did the dirty work while her
sisters preened themselves" [syn: {dirty}, {soiled},
{unclean}] [ant: {clean}]
2: having a physical or moral blemish so as to make impure
according to dietary or ceremonial laws; "unclean meat"; "and
the swine...is unclean to you"-Leviticus 11:3 [syn:
{unclean}, {impure}] [ant: {clean}]
